What are timers and counters in microcontrollers?
Answer
Timers count clock pulses to measure time intervals, generate delays, or create periodic interrupts. Counters count external events via an input pin. Most microcontrollers offer dual-function timer/counter units. Common modes include: Timer mode (internal clock), Counter mode (external events), PWM generation, Input capture (measure pulse width), and Output compare (generate precise timing). The 8051 has two 16-bit timers (Timer 0, Timer 1) with multiple modes. Timers are essential for precise timing, PWM, and real-time applications.
